As part of our efforts to honour Black History Month, we invite you to join us for a panel discussion at our on cultivating a robust pipeline of Black legal talent on Monday, February 26th from 12:00 pm – 1:00 pm E.T., followed by a 15-minute Q&A.

This event is held in association with the Fasken Black Collective.

Featuring expert panel members:

The discussion will include:

  • Practical insights and strategies to actively build a pipeline of Black legal talent
  • Examination of the pivotal stages and opportunities to support greater inclusion of Black students and professionals during the legal lifecycle
  • The significant impact of implementing support networks, specifically mentorship and sponsorship programs, on the career development path for Black Lawyers
  • Actionable steps towards building a more representative and equitable future for the legal profession
